Jon Karlsson

Jon Karlsson is Professor of Orthopaedics and Sports Traumatology at the Sahlgrenska Academy, Gothenburg University, Sweden.

Originally from Iceland, Jon has worked at Sahlgrenska University Hospital since 1981. His clinical focus is knee surgery, with an emphasis on complex knee injuries, knee dislocations and revision surgery, but he also works as a Foot and Ankle surgeon.

His PhD thesis in 1989 was devoted to Chronic Lateral Ankle Instability, and since then he has more than 500 peer-reviewed publications, more than 100 book chapters and over 40 textbooks in orthopaedics and sports traumatology. Jon has mentored 56 PhD students, and is currently the chief Editor of Knee Surgery Sports Traumatology Arthroscopy (KSSTA). He has been the care-taking physician to the IFK Göteborg professional football club since 1984.
